Industrial Gearbox Market Outlook 2026–2030: Key Drivers and Trends
The global industrial gearbox market is projected to grow from approximately $29.4 billion in 2025 to $38.7 billion by 2030, at a compound annual growth rate (CAGR) of 4.8%. Growth is distributed unevenly across product types, end sectors and geographies — understanding the shape of that growth is relevant for procurement teams planning long-term sourcing strategies, OEM buyers selecting component partners, and maintenance managers assessing the availability of replacement units over equipment lifetimes.
Market Size and Forecast Methodology
The figures cited here aggregate data from multiple industry research providers and cross-reference them against publicly reported revenue from the five largest gearbox manufacturers: SEW-Eurodrive, Siemens (Flender), Bonfiglioli, Nord Drivesystems, and Sumitomo. Combined, these five account for approximately 38% of the market by revenue. The remaining share is split among several hundred regional and specialist manufacturers, with strong clusters in Germany, Italy, China, India and Japan.
The $38.7B projection assumes continued moderate growth in manufacturing output across OECD economies and accelerating capex in renewable energy infrastructure and logistics automation. A global industrial recession scenario would compress growth to approximately 2.5–3.0% CAGR, yielding a 2030 market of roughly $33.5B.
Product Type Breakdown
Helical and bevel-helical gearboxes collectively represent the largest product segment, accounting for approximately 41% of market revenue. Their dominance reflects their presence in the broadest range of applications — conveyors, mixers, agitators, and general mechanical drives across every industrial sector.
- Helical/Bevel-Helical: 41% share. Expected CAGR 4.5%. Driven by conveyor system expansion in logistics and e-commerce distribution.
- Planetary: 22% share. Expected CAGR 6.2% — fastest-growing segment. Growth driven by robotics, wind turbines (pitch and yaw drives) and precision servo applications.
- Worm: 18% share. Expected CAGR 3.1%. Mature market; strong in packaging and material handling.
- Bevel (right-angle): 11% share. Expected CAGR 4.8%. Growing in agitator and mixer applications for chemical and food sectors.
- Other (cycloidal, harmonic, custom): 8% share. CAGR 5.9%, driven by collaborative robot and AGV growth.
Geographic Distribution
Asia-Pacific (APAC) holds the largest regional share at approximately 42%, reflecting the scale of Chinese and Indian manufacturing capacity. However, Chinese domestic demand growth is moderating as heavy industry matures, and the fastest regional growth rate is now found in South and Southeast Asia (India, Vietnam, Indonesia) at approximately 7% CAGR, driven by manufacturing relocation from China and infrastructure investment.
Europe accounts for approximately 27% of the market, with Germany, Italy and France as the primary demand centres. European growth (3.8% CAGR) is supported by the EU Green Deal's industrial electrification programmes, which drive demand for high-efficiency gearmotor assemblies in manufacturing and building services.
North America holds an 18% share at approximately 4.2% CAGR, with the primary drivers being automotive assembly automation (EV platform retooling), semiconductor facility construction, and data centre mechanical systems.
The Middle East and Africa (MEA) region, while small in absolute terms (approximately 5% share), shows 6.5% CAGR — the second fastest — driven by Saudi Vision 2030 industrial diversification, desalination plant expansion, and oil and gas processing investment in the UAE and Oman. Turkey, which sits at the intersection of European and MEA supply chains, shows 5.8% CAGR and is increasingly a manufacturing base for European-brand gearbox assembly under licence.
Key Demand Drivers
Renewable Energy Infrastructure
Wind turbine pitch and yaw control systems use planetary gearboxes in both onshore and offshore installations. The global pipeline of offshore wind projects committing to final investment decision between 2025 and 2027 — approximately 35 GW in Europe and Asia-Pacific combined — represents a significant discrete demand event for large planetary units. Gearbox suppliers including Bonfiglioli, Brevini (now Dana) and Rexnord have invested in dedicated wind-segment manufacturing lines.
Logistics and E-Commerce Automation
Automated sortation and conveying systems in distribution centres typically use one helical gearmotor per conveyor section. A single large distribution facility can contain 3,000–8,000 gearmotors. The continued expansion of e-commerce fulfilment infrastructure — particularly in Europe and India — is the most consistent volume driver for standard helical gearmotors in the 0.37–7.5 kW range.
Industrial Energy Efficiency Regulations
The same EU Ecodesign regulations that mandate IE3 and IE5 motors (Regulation 2019/1781) also incentivise the pairing of high-efficiency motors with high-efficiency gearboxes. Gearbox manufacturers are responding by publishing IE class designations for integrated gearmotors and pushing overall drivetrain efficiency values. This is shifting some procurement decisions from component-by-component selection to integrated gearmotor sourcing, which concentrates purchasing power with a smaller number of suppliers.
Supply Chain Observations
Lead times for large-frame planetary and bevel-helical gearboxes (output torque above 50,000 Nm) stretched to 24–32 weeks in 2022–2023 due to casting and gear hobbing capacity constraints. As of Q1 2026, lead times have normalised to 10–16 weeks for standard catalogue units from SEW-Eurodrive, Flender and Bonfiglioli. Custom ratio or special sealing specifications continue to carry 18–24 week lead times.
